diff options
author | Jussi Pakkanen <jpakkane@gmail.com> | 2017-11-11 01:53:23 +0200 |
---|---|---|
committer | Jussi Pakkanen <jpakkane@gmail.com> | 2017-11-20 23:08:17 +0200 |
commit | 5d51bc79c7555e681a0c638da9528458257744ae (patch) | |
tree | 9d8e24be05870144a8763a094a8b273fd657c262 /mesonbuild/scripts | |
parent | b3dfb80c15cae24c66d07425bb7a327528438a55 (diff) | |
download | meson-5d51bc79c7555e681a0c638da9528458257744ae.zip meson-5d51bc79c7555e681a0c638da9528458257744ae.tar.gz meson-5d51bc79c7555e681a0c638da9528458257744ae.tar.bz2 |
Replaced sys.executable use with the mesonlib equivalent.
Diffstat (limited to 'mesonbuild/scripts')
-rw-r--r-- | mesonbuild/scripts/regen_checker.py | 14 |
1 files changed, 5 insertions, 9 deletions
diff --git a/mesonbuild/scripts/regen_checker.py b/mesonbuild/scripts/regen_checker.py index 53c5428..e8fbd19 100644 --- a/mesonbuild/scripts/regen_checker.py +++ b/mesonbuild/scripts/regen_checker.py @@ -32,15 +32,11 @@ def need_regen(regeninfo, regen_timestamp): return False def regen(regeninfo, mesonscript, backend): - if sys.executable.lower().endswith('meson.exe'): - cmd_exe = [sys.executable] - else: - cmd_exe = [sys.executable, mesonscript] - cmd = cmd_exe + ['--internal', - 'regenerate', - regeninfo.build_dir, - regeninfo.source_dir, - '--backend=' + backend] + cmd = mesonlib.meson_command + ['--internal', + 'regenerate', + regeninfo.build_dir, + regeninfo.source_dir, + '--backend=' + backend] subprocess.check_call(cmd) def run(args): |